相关文章

人脸操作:从检测到识别的全景指南

人脸操作:从检测到识别的全景指南 在现代计算机视觉技术中,人脸操作是一个非常重要的领域。人脸操作不仅包括检测图像中的人脸,还涉及到人脸识别、表情分析、面部特征提取等任务。这些技术在各种应用中发挥着关键作用,从社交媒体…

cv::normalize()

cv::normalize()函数是OpenCV库中用于对矩阵或图像数据进行归一化处理的工具。归一化是图像处理和计算机视觉中常见的预处理步骤,它可以确保数据在一定范围内,从而有助于后续的处理和算法的稳定性和性能。cv::normalize()函数可以将输入矩阵的值缩放到一…

跨平台控制神器Escrcpy,您的智能生活助手

Escrcpy 是一款基于 Scrcpy 开发的图形化安卓手机投屏控制软件,它允许用户将 Android 手机屏幕实时镜像到电脑上,并使用电脑的鼠标和键盘直接操作手机,实现了无线且高效的操控。这款软件是免费开源的,支持跨平台使用,包…

AI大模型学习

AI大模型学习 学习 AI 大模型涉及多个方面,包括理论知识、实践经验和技术工具的掌握。下面是学习 AI 大模型的一般步骤和建议: 1.理解基本概念: 开始学习前,确保你对人工智能、机器学习和深度学习的基本概念有一定的了解。学习神…

RabbitMQ入门到高级

RabbitMQ 1、初识MQ 1.1、同步调用 同步调用的优势是: 时效性强,等待到结果后才返回 同步调用的问题是: 扩展性差性能下降级联失败问题 1.2、异步调用 异步调用通常是基于消息通知的方式,包含三个角色: 消息发送…

一文打通pytorch中几个常见的张量操作

在张量操作中,unsqueeze,squeeze,reshape,view 1. unsqueeze 功能: 在指定维度上增加一个新的维度,通常用于将一维张量扩展为二维,以便符合批处理的要求。举例:import torchx torch.tensor([1, 2, 3]) # Shape: (3,) y x.unsqueeze(0) …

《AI视频类工具之五——​ 开拍》

一.简介 官网:开拍 - 用AI制作口播视频用AI制作口播视频https://www.kaipai.com/home?ref=ai-bot.cn 开拍是一款由美图公司在2023年推出,利用AI技术制作的短视频分享应用。这款工具通过AI赋能,为用户提供了从文案创作、视频拍摄到视频剪辑、包装的一站式解决方案,极大地…

回顾加密风险投资15年演变:步履维艰,但总体向上

1. 引言:加密风险投资的历程 过去15年,加密领域经历了从默默无闻到引爆全球金融市场的巨大变迁。风投机构(VC)在这一过程中扮演了重要角色,推动了区块链和加密货币行业的快速发展。本文将探讨加密风险投资的动态演变&…

Android全面解析之Context机制(一) :初识Android context

什么是Context 回想一下最初学习Android开发的时候,第一用到context是什么时候?如果你跟我一样是通过郭霖的《第一行代码》来入门android,那么一般是Toast。Toast的常规用法是: Toast.makeText(this, "我是toast", To…

《python语言程序设计》2018版第7章第03题Account类设计一个Account类

设计一个Account类 题面新的改变 题面 大家好,昨天停更了一次,因为买的二手苹果pro电脑,有很多问题没有 明白,在二手商家的指导下,完成重装系统,再装双系统。等等操作。再去健身房,基本上人已累…

自动化解决 reCAPTCHA v2:CapSolver 教程

对于那些经常进行网页爬取的人来说,你是否曾觉得 reCAPTCHA v2 就像是互联网版的过于严格的裁判员,总是在质疑你的真实性?但如果你能够轻松且合规地与这些裁判员达成和解,使你的网络搜索和自动化任务变得更顺畅,那该有…

NVIDIA Hands-on Lab——Building RAG Agents with LLMs

NVIDIA DLI RAG课程(Course Detail | NVIDIA ),并获得该课程证书。 1 07的ipynb文件中设定,使用这两个模型配置 embedder NVIDIAEmbeddings(model"nvidia/nv-embed-v1", truncate"END") # ChatNVIDIA.get_available_mo…

大话C语言:第40篇 结构体指针​

结构体指针是C语言中一种特殊的指针类型,它指向一个结构体变量。结构体指针可以用来访问结构体的成员,同时也可以作为函数参数进行传递,以便在函数内部操作结构体的数据。 结构体指针的定义方式与定义其他类型的指针类似,只是指针…

Java-捕获线程异常

在Java中,捕获线程异常可以通过多种方式实现。一种常用的方法是利用 Thread.UncaughtExceptionHandler接口。这个接口允许你定义一个处理器来处理线程中未被捕获 的异常。 下面是一个简单的工具类示例,展示了如何使用Thread.UncaughtExceptionHandler来捕获线程中 的异常…

input dispatching timeout OS 版本对应反应

input dispatching timeout 主线程耗时超过5s且有下一个输入事件在卡顿阶段输入,才会引发ANR。 验证不同系统下对于此类ANR的产生情况 阻塞情况/是否阻塞 android 14 Android13 Android12 Android11 Android10 Android9 Android8 前台 输入事件后主线程阻…

如何禁止盗版软件联网?三个方法远离盗版软件危害

禁止盗版软件联网是维护网络安全和防止非法数据交流的重要措施。以下是一些方法,包括使用安企神来禁止盗版软件联网的具体步骤。 1.通过防火墙禁止软件联网 防火墙是计算机上的一道安全屏障,可以阻止未经授权的网络流量。通过配置防火墙规则&#xff0…

c语言fprintf和Uint32

一、fprintf 在C语言中,fprintf函数用于将格式化的输出写入到一个已经打开的文件流中。这与printf函数非常相似,不同的是printf是将输出打印到标准输出设备(通常是显示器),而fprintf可以将数据写入到指定的文件中。 …

python实现每天定时发送邮件

文章目录 步骤 1: 安装所需的库步骤 2: 编写发送电子邮件的 Python 脚本步骤 3: 配置电子邮件发送服务步骤 4: 运行脚本进一步扩展 要编写一个用于自动发送每日电子邮件报告的 Python 脚本,并配置它在每天的特定时间发送电子邮件,使用 smtplib 和 emai…

【Python】 使用 SQLAlchemy 连接 ClickHouse 数据库

我最爱的那首歌最爱的angel 我到什么时候才能遇见我的angel 我最爱的那首歌最爱的angel 我不是王子也会拥有我的angel 🎵 张杰《云中的angel》 在这篇博客中,我们将介绍如何使用 SQLAlchemy 在 Python 中连接到 ClickHouse 数据库。…

SQL 的困难源于关系代数

在结构化数据计算领域,SQL 现在还是应用最广泛的工作语言,不仅被所有关系数据库采用,许多新进的大数据平台也将实现 SQL 作为目标。 对于某种计算技术,人们通常会关心两个效率。一是运算的描述效率,二是运算的执行效率…